Next day delivery to home or free to store.*
filters:456 size:36 KB
Clear All Filters
White Long Sleeve Shirt With Linen
£28
White Sleeveless Shirt
£26.50
Multi Embroidered Beach Shirt With Linen
£42
Mid Blue Oversize Denim 100% Cotton Shirt
£30
White Short Sleeve Broderie Shell Shirt
£34
Green Standard Collar Cotton Linen Blend Short Sleeve Shirt
Yellow 100% Cotton Beach Shirt Cover-Up
£35
Rinse Linen Wide Leg Denim N. Premium Tailored Trousers
£52
White Standard Collar Cotton Linen Blend Short Sleeve Shirt
Neutral/Brown Stripe 100% Linen Button Down Relaxed Long Sleeve Shirt
£48
Yellow Stripe Graphic Long Sleeve 100% Cotton Relaxed Lightweight Shirt
£36
White 100% Linen Button Down Relaxed Long Sleeve Shirt
£46